In the fall, you charge your neighbors $9 for going to their house to rake leaves, then $6 for every
hour you rake. If you make $51 one day, how many hours did you spend raking?

Respuesta :

1. Summarize the data given.

You know that you made $51 in just one day. You charge $9 for going to their house, plus $6 hours for raking.

9 + 6x = 51

X = The Hours Spent Raking

2. Turn the equation so then 6x is by itself.

9 + 6x = 51

-9             -9

6x = 42

3. Remove the number, so x remains by itself.

6x = 42

/6    /6

x = 7

So that means, you spent 7 hours raking leaves on the day I made 51 dollars.
